| | Outlook 2007 Are there any known issues with Vista and Outlook 2007. After installation of Outlook 2007 and upon activation outlook searches for a PST file which it accepts. On openeing any mail in the inbox it then tries to re configure outlook then comes up with an error 1719. I have since installed Office 2003 using the same pst file and all is ok. |

| | Re: Outlook 2007 Hi Vaughan Using Vista Ultimate and Office Professional 2007, absolutely no problems here using any of the software. We use Outlook 2007 extensively and the only slight problem was installing PST Back-up, which requires installing differently to Oulook in Office 2003. You may have a corrupted file as error 1719 normally denotes problems with the Windows Installer file not being registered correctlt the file reference is msiexec.exe. You can either re-register the file or totally uninstall Office 2007>Reboot>Re-Install Office. Ensure that no AV or 3rd Party Internet Security Suite is running before re-installing.
